Rural Municipality of Stanley No. 215

The Rural Municipality of Stanley No. 215 (2016 population: ) is a rural municipality (RM) in the Canadian province of Saskatchewan within Census Division No. 5 and SARM Division No. 1. It is located in the southeast portion of the province.

History

The RM of Stanley No. 215 incorporated as a rural municipality on January 1, 1913.

Government

The RM of Stanley No. 215 is governed by an elected municipal council and an appointed administrator that meets on the second Tuesday of every month. The reeve of the RM is Max Halyk while its administrator is Dawn Oehler. The RM's office is located in Melville.
